Re: Bumble Bee

A bumblebee is a member of the bee genus Bombus, in the family Apidae. This genus is the only extant group in the tribe Bombini, though a few extinct related genera (e.g., Calyptapis) are known from fossils.
Bumblebees have round bodies covered in soft hair called pile, making them appear and feel fuzzy.

Scientific classification
Kingdom
Animalia

Phylum
Arthropoda

Class
Insecta

Order
Hymenoptera

Family
Apidae

Subfamily
Apinae

Tribe
Bombini

Genus
Bombus

According to the Oxford English Dictionary (OED), the term "bumblebee" was first recorded as having been used in the English language in the 1530 work Lesclarcissement by John Palsgrave
